A link. There are different types, but most are forms of hyperlinks. Hyperlinks do not have to be on the internet. You can have them within documents or document to document. You can also have communications links or data that has been posted direct from one location to another and maintains a link back to the original so that it changes when the source does. This is often done by a paste link operation, after the initial data has been copied.
Copy leaves the information in its original location and makes another copy of the information when you use Paste. But in moving it removes the information and pastes it to another location.
A temporary location where information is stored before being pasted into another location is called the clipboard. When you copy or cut text or images on a computer or mobile device, they are temporarily stored in the clipboard. You can then paste this information into another location using the paste command.

FTP uses two parallel TCP connections, one connection for sending control information (such as a request to transfer a file) and another connection for actually transferring the file. Because the control information is not sent over the same connection that the file is sent over, FTP sends control information out of band.
